The Chukyo Industrial Zone, anchored by Nagoya, constitutes the beating heart of Japanese heavy manufacturing. Bordered by the major petrochemical and refining complexes of the Yokkaichi and Chita peninsulas, it requires process motors designed with maximum safety indices. Any electrical drive deployed in these environments must conform to tight localized safety mandates.
In volatile areas containing combustible gases (such as hydrogen, ethylene, and methane) or carbonaceous dusts, standard AC induction motors risk sparking and igniting the surroundings. Flameproof (Ex d) and increased safety (Ex e) motors are therefore critical to safeguarding workers and capital assets.
Nagoya is spearheading Japan's shift toward hydrogen energy integration, including hydrogen fueling stations and fuel-cell powered heavy logistics. Generating, compressing, and storing hydrogen requires industrial machinery certified under Group IIC criteria, representing the most stringent explosion mitigation category due to hydrogen's low ignition energy.

Dating back to the year 1999, WOLONG has jointly started the business with OLI vibration motor in China. OLI Brand owns the largest market for vibration motors and Ex vibration sensors around the globe.
In 2011, WOLONG acquired 97.94% of the Austrian ATB Group (ATB motor), becoming the actual controller of one of Europe's top three motor manufacturers. The ATB group includes historical brands such as Morley (mining equipment, with a history of nearly 130 years) and Laurence Scott (nuclear reactor power plant drives and low-starting-current naval vessels equipment). Concurrently, Schorch Electric Motor (established in 1882) joined the WOLONG portfolio, providing systems for oil and gas, shipbuilding, and water management.
In 2015, WOLONG Electric Nanyang Explosion-proof Group Co., Ltd. (CNE), China's largest explosion-proof motor scientific research and production base, officially joined the WOLONG Group. This merger brought deep capabilities in designing Ex-proof high voltage motors, positive-pressure motors, and underground coal mine equipment.
In 2018, General Electric's (GE) commercial and industrial motor division joined the ranks of WOLONG. This integration provided technical support and global supply chain networks across heavy chemical industries, paper mills, and material processing systems.

The rotor features the squirrel cage design, with cast aluminum rotors being widely utilized. These rotors are produced using either centrifugal aluminum casting or die-casting techniques, where molten pure aluminum is poured into the slots of the rotor core, resulting in a single-piece construction that integrates the rotor bars and end rings. The structural integrity and manufacturing process of cast aluminum rotors guarantee the motor rotor's reliability, and also endow the motor with outstanding torque properties. For larger capacity motors, copper bar rotors are employed, which benefit from dependable bar securing and end ring welding procedures. Additionally, the protective ring design of high-speed motors further ensures the reliable operation of the copper bar rotor.
The coil is crafted from polyester film and reinforced with glass cloth, utilizing either low-powder mica tape with a high mica content or medium-powdered mica tape with an abundance of mica. Following the VPI (Vacuum Pressure Impregnation) process, a pristine white coil emerges from the production line. After the billet is extracted from the wire, it proceeds through the VPI process to transform into a finished unit. The winding and insulation are meticulously engineered to provide exceptional electrical performance, mechanical strength, resistance to moisture, and thermal stability.
The motor frame employs a fully digital platform for structural and fluid multi-physics field simulations. This simulation platform retains the original patent's structure and design, utilizing mature, high-strength cast iron (or steel as an alternative). The frame boasts exceptional structural redundancy, outstanding heat dissipation properties, and ample inherent frequency isolation margins for the entire machine. It is engineered to endure significant mechanical shocks, maintain a superior vibration level, and ensure a lower temperature increase in the motor.
The low-noise fan cover system comprises a fan cover body, an air guide cylinder, a protective window, and a silencer plate. Its compact structure and lightweight design facilitate vibration reduction. The air inlet is situated on the side, which optimizes the avoidance of obstacles behind the motor, minimizing adverse effects on ventilation and reducing noise caused by energy loss during propagation path changes. The system also incorporates sound-absorbing materials that absorb noise, thereby lowering the overall motor noise. Additionally, the fan cover is rated IP22, ensuring that hands cannot come into contact with the fan.

Automobile assembly lines in Nagoya use solvent-based painting booths with volatile organic compounds (VOCs). These areas are classified as Zone 1 or Zone 2 hazardous locations. Our low voltage variable frequency explosion-proof motors (such as the WEBP3 and YBBP series) provide flame containment and speed control for ventilation fans and recirculation systems.
The Port of Nagoya manages bulk storage facilities for liquefied chemical cargos and oil derivatives. Driving fluid pumps, loading arms, and vapor recovery systems requires motors with Class Ex d sealing. Our YBX3 and YBX4 series motors provide spark prevention and protection against outdoor salt spray corrosion.
Nagoya's municipal hydrogen distribution infrastructure requires high-pressure compressors to store hydrogen gas. These environments require Class IIC certified explosion-proof motors. Our variable frequency drive solutions maintain reliable starting torque while complying with flameproof standards.
